Jackpotjoy Launch RSPCA Week Charity Games

LONDON, April 19, 2010--     The animal lovers at Jackpotjoy (http://www.jackpotjoy.com) have offered
to donate GBP1 to the RSPCA for every player who buys four tickets for one of
their special RSPCA week Bingo games! Get more info on the games by visiting
http://www.jackpotjoy.com/promotions/current

    RSPCA week runs between the 26th of April and the 2nd of May 2010 and the
site are offering three Charity Bingo games a day in their all new Pub Room,
at 9am, 1pm and 6pm. The animal welfare charity will be guaranteed the GBP1
donation each time a player buys four tickets.

    JACKPOTJOY

    Jackpotjoy is one of the country's most popular soft gaming sites. It
offers browser based bingo, slots and casino games, and pays our over GBP1
billion a year to more than 3,000,000 members.

    Jackpotjoy offers more than 60 games, costing between 1p and GBP2,500 a
go. The site is famous for creating strong partnerships with top gameshows
including Price is Right, Strike it Lucky, Family Fortunes. Their Deal or No
Deal games pay out over GBP5 million a year and last year made two new
millionaires.
